Output 73515f74a4e1c0968222359c9276accd89b51780306abe6b25e3254dc2e92ffb:1

value
14948818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ca41aec23a75418fa69eb15097e879e4c30e6dc OP_EQUAL
address
3MofAyQH57LQ5NSHgvWGQkRyjr7vpCTWLg
transaction
73515f74a4e1c0968222359c9276accd89b51780306abe6b25e3254dc2e92ffb
spent
true